Nonspecific vaginitis treatment medication

1. Take clindamycin orally, twice a day for 7 consecutive days.

2. Take metronidazole orally, twice a day for 7 consecutive days.

3. Apply metronidazole topically. Metronidazole is placed into the vagina and a course of treatment lasts one week.

4. Apply gel disinfectant inside the vagina once every night for 7 consecutive days.

Trichomonas vaginitis treatment medication

Patients with this type of vaginitis need both internal and external treatment to eliminate the Trichomonas that live in the urethra, intestines, cervical glands and wrinkles. It can be treated with both Western and Chinese medicine.

Vulvar itching and redness are generally caused by bacterial infection, which leads to vaginal inflammation. You can go to the hospital for a leucorrhea examination. If it is confirmed to be vaginitis, you should receive timely symptomatic treatment.
